Onboarding: the Hargleton monolith's user module is being split into the Wrenfall service. During cutover, writes dual-publish to both stores; the on-call engineer must verify parity nightly. If the reconciler jams, unseal the migration vault and replay events manually. The vault unseals with the recovery passphrase that follows below.

unlock words, yawig-kagef: gordor-holvan-ulaael-pramir-ulaiel-tamdor

## Parity check — Lanternfall SDKs

Before tagging, confirm the Kotlin and Swift clients expose identical surface for v4.2: retry policies, pagination cursors, and the new offline queue. Run `parity-audit` against both; zero diffs required. Any intentional gap needs a linked waiver from the Harrowgate platform group. Once parity passes, cut the tag on both repos in the same hour to keep changelogs aligned. Sign the release manifests with the key below.

rollout seal: bky13_5SmQLGDquKdog

Onboarding note for the Ledgerpane admin table: bulk edits are applied through the batcher service, not directly against the database. Select rows, choose an action, and the batcher stages changes in a pending set you can review before commit. Edits over 500 rows require a second approver — this is enforced server-side, so don't try to chunk around it. To run the batcher locally you need the staging write credential, which goes in your .env as the next line.

secret setting of bahip-kagag: RELAY_SECRET3=c83

Onboarding note — Pixelhollow image cache leak

Support team: customers on Pixelhollow 4.2 may report steadily rising memory in the thumbnail cache. This is a known leak in the eviction path; a patch ships in 4.2.3. Advise a restart as a stopgap, then escalate to tier two. To open the encrypted diagnostics bundle, enter the recovery passphrase shown immediately below.

unlock words, hahip-baduf: holwyn-istath-julvan